Output 13021b463c59847e6c73aa3575f0d4d8a962516d404bb578ec6a1d7194404129:8

value
320386020
script pubkey
OP_0 OP_PUSHBYTES_20 907baf1934f106bfac8d6cb39d6bd65d85bdb528
address
bc1qjpa67xf57yrtltyddjee667ktkzmmdfgkkcdgd
transaction
13021b463c59847e6c73aa3575f0d4d8a962516d404bb578ec6a1d7194404129
spent
true